Dancing robot

The Dancing Robot was my project in the Tinker.it Toy Hacking workshop. It was made using only electronics, that were gathered from existing toys.

John N's Robot 4

My dancing robot was made from 3 separate toy:

  1. a lightstick, made up of 4 LEDs,
  2. a cat, that meowed and flashed its eyes whenever it heard loud noises,
  3. and a dog, that danced and sang a song whenever you squeezed his toe.

I isolated the different functions of the circuits to give me:

  1. a drum machine powered by LED pulses,
  2. a microphone,
  3. two motors that could be triggered.

The drum machine was the sound (input), the microphone recieved this and triggered a relay (control) which activated the motors (output).
